If the news is to be believed, underwater bullet train in India will soon offer trips. The nation paid $964 million for Japan’s 18 E5 series bullet trains. The trains have been observed travelling as fast as 217 km/h.
The first bullet train is anticipated to run between Mumbai and Ahmedabad, cutting the distance’s eight-hour travel time in half. The underwater section between Thane Creek and Virar adds to the allure of this train!
Learn All the Information on Underwater Bullet Train in India
From BKC to Kalyan Shilphata, a 21-kilometer underground tunnel for the bullet train project would go through the state of Maharashtra. The Thane brook is located beneath this underwater canyon, around 7 kilometres away. According to the report, a 1.8 km-long section of this will be built below the seabed, and the remaining length will be erected on either side of the creek beneath mangrove marshes.
